Helly Hansen has been making high quality outdoor wear since 1877 when captain Helly Juell Hansen began selling products made of coarse linen soaked in linseed oil to keep sailors dry. While they are still known for their high quality sailing gear, Helly Hansen has expanded their line to include everything from ski jackets to casual wear.
